Bug description:
  Runinng dual boot XUbuntu 16.04 on an Asus UX303LNB laptop.

  Prior to today's updates, I got the black os selection boot screen,
  then the Xubuntu login prompt.

  Since the updates, I get a blue-turquoise Debian boot screen,with the
  DEbian text covering the instructions of what options I have, followed
  by a long screen of text [OK] thing thing thing...

  At shutdown, I get that long screen of text again...

  I did not install any new software, but this is really not what I
  want.

  I do not have a /etc/default/grub file so it is very hard for me to
  see how to fix this.

  Anyway, it is a bug because it is new, incorrect behavior that I did
  not request...
